Durability and Maintenance
One of the primary benefits of high chain link fences is their durability. Constructed from galvanized steel wire, these fences are designed to withstand harsh weather conditions, including heavy winds, rain, and snow. The galvanized coating not only adds to the fence's longevity but also protects it from rust and corrosion, ensuring it remains sturdy over time. In fact, a well-installed chain link fence can last for decades with minimal maintenance, making it a cost-effective investment for property owners.
In terms of maintenance, high chain link fences require very little effort to keep them in good condition. Regular inspections to check for any damage or loose fittings are typically sufficient. If a section becomes damaged, replacing that part is quick and easy, allowing for seamless repairs that won't disrupt the overall integrity of the fence.
Security Features
Security is often the primary concern for those considering fencing options, and high chain link fences excel in this area. Their height can deter intruders and prevent unauthorized access to your property. Adding features such as barbed wire at the top further enhances security, making it difficult for intruders to scale the fence.
High chain link fences can also be equipped with additional security measures such as gates, locks, and even surveillance cameras. This adaptability makes them a suitable choice for high-security areas like warehouses, schools, and sports facilities, where preventing unauthorized entry is crucial.
Visibility and Aesthetic Appeal
Another significant advantage of high chain link fences is their transparency. Unlike solid fences, which can create a sense of enclosure, chain link fences allow for visibility. This feature can be particularly beneficial for businesses that want to showcase their premises while still maintaining a secure boundary. The open design provides a feeling of space and openness, making it easier to monitor activities both inside and outside the enclosure.
Moreover, chain link fences come in various heights and styles, including colored vinyl coatings which can make them more aesthetically pleasing and blend better with the landscape. Whether you prefer a traditional silver look or a subtle green or black tone, there is a high chain link fence option that can complement your property's design.
Cost-Effectiveness
In terms of cost, high chain link fences are one of the most affordable fencing solutions available. The initial installation costs are typically lower than those for wooden or vinyl fences, making them accessible for a wider range of budgets. Furthermore, the low upkeep expenses associated with chain link fencing contribute to its overall cost-effectiveness. Property owners can invest their savings into other areas while enjoying a secure and functional perimeter.
